Introduction

Analysis of the core content of the standard

Performance indicators Type I plywood General requirements
Bond strength (MPa) ≥1.00 ≥0.70
In-plane shear strength (MPa) ≥3.2
Elastic modulus (104MPa) 5.0-8.0

Key performance test methods

Static bending strength test

The four-point bending method is used, and the universal mechanical testing machine is used. The specimen length must meet 50 times the basic thickness, and the loading speed is controlled below 14.7MPa/min. Calculation formula:

σ = 3PL/(2bh2)

Where P is the failure load, L is the support spacing, b is the specimen width, and h is the thickness.


Material structure requirements

  • The textures of adjacent layers of veneers should be perpendicular to each other
  • Symmetrical layers of veneers should be of the same species and thickness
  • The thickness of the surface layer accounts for 40%-70%
  • When the thickness is >24mm, the number of layers must be ≥7

Quality judgment rules

Item Qualification standard Re-inspection threshold
Bond strength Qualified specimens ≥90% 70%-90%
Moisture content Qualified specimens ≥90% 70%-90%
Formaldehyde emission Meet the limit of GB 18580

Suggestions for the implementation of the standard

  1. Give priority to products that have passed the thermal durability test (800-900℃ flame for 10 minutes without separation)
  2. Pay attention to the performance difference between thickness classification (ES grade) and strength classification (F grade)
  3. The calibration certificate of testing equipment such as Bunsen burner should be checked during project acceptance
  4. Keep flat during storage to avoid moisture and deformation
